- BP sells 57% stake in Kirkuk to ConocoPhillips and TPAO
- ADNOC Gas takes FID on US$8.2 billion RGD Phases 2 and 3
- Houthi attacks add pressure as Saudi onshore storage reaches war-time high
- Houthi blockade undermines Saudi Arabia's Red Sea export lifeline
- Saudi Aramco Q2 results: profits rise despite supply disruption
- Iraq and Türkiye sign a one-year extension to the ITP
- Conflict widens to Egypt as regasification and storage infrastructure struck
- Kuwait and Saudi agree to increase production at the Wafra field
- Eni approves Cronos: Cyprus gas destined for Egypt LNG exports
- Saudi Arabia faces mounting export risks as Red Sea attacks reach Yanbu and Abqaiq
- KPC signs giant midstream deal with Blackstone, Brookfield and KKR
- Iraq opens Qaiyarah Integrated Project to competitive bidding
